Albert Barnes' Notes on the Whole Bible - John 1:39
Come and see - This was a kind and gracious answer. He did not put them off to some future period. Then, as now, he was willing that they should come at once and enjoy the full opportunity which they desired of his conversation. Jesus is ever ready to admit those who seek him to his presence and favor.Abode with him - Remained with him. This was probably the dwelling of some friend of Jesus. The Pulpit Commentary - John 1:39
He saith to them, Come, and ye shall see . £ "A parable of the message of faith" (Westcott). Some have compared the expression with ἔρου καὶ βλέπε , thrice repeated (T.R.) in Revelation 6:1-17 .; but it is unnecessary to do so. Faith precedes revelation as well as follows it. They came, and saw where he was abiding.
